9 / 11 page ![]() DIO7758 www.dioo.com © 2022 DIOO MICROCIRCUITS CO., LTD DIO7758• Rev. 1.6 Detailed Description Overview The DIO7758 series of LDO linear regulators is low quiescent current devices with excellent line and load transient performance. These LDOs are designed for power-sensitive applications. A precision bandgap and error amplifier provide overall 1% accuracy. Low output noise, very high PSRR, and low dropout voltage make this series of devices ideal for most battery-operated handheld equipment. All device versions have integrated thermal shutdown, and current limit. Block Diagram Internal Current Limit The DIO7758 internal current limit helps to protect the regulator during fault conditions. During the current limit, the output sources a fixed amount of current that is largely independent of the output voltage. In such a case, the output voltage is not regulated and is VOUT = ICL × RLOAD. The PMOS pass transistor dissipates (VIN – VOUT) × ICL until the thermal shutdown is triggered and the device turns off. As the device cools down, it is turned on by the internal thermal shutdown circuit. If the fault condition continues, the device cycles between the current limit and thermal shutdown. The PMOS pass element in the DIO7758 has a built-in body diode that conducts current when the voltage at OUT exceeds the voltage at IN. This current is not limited, so if extended reverse voltage operation is anticipated, external limiting to 5% of the rated output current is recommended. Shut down The enable pin (EN) is active high. The device is enabled when the voltage at EN pin goes above 1 V. The device is turned off when the EN pin is held at less than 0.4 V. When shutdown capability is not required, EN can be connected to the IN pin. Dropout Voltage The DIO7758 uses a PMOS pass transistor to achieve low dropout. When (VIN – VOUT) is less than the dropout voltage (VDO), the PMOS pass device is in the linear region of operation and the input-to-output resistance is the RDS(on) of the PMOS pass element.
